Recognition Programs for Abortion Providers

Funding for recognition programs aimed at honoring abortion providers in California has emerged as a crucial initiative in the current healthcare landscape. This program specifically targets award systems designed to celebrate exemplary service within the field of abortion and reproductive health. It encompasses various award categories ranging from clinical excellence to community advocacy but excludes funding for direct service delivery or procedural costs associated with abortions.

Honorary Examples and Their Impact For instance, one successful application of this funding involved a local clinic that created an annual award ceremony to recognize its practitioners' commitment and expertise. The event not only celebrated achievements but also generated local media coverage, increasing public awareness about the importance of reproductive health services. Additionally, another clinic launched a campaign highlighting recipient stories through social media platforms, positively influencing the community's perception of abortion care. These initiatives demonstrate how recognition can directly enhance provider morale and encourage professionals to strive for excellence in a challenging environment.

Who Should Apply? This funding opportunity is ideal for healthcare organizations, including clinics and advocacy groups, that actively engage in reproductive health services. Applications should clearly demonstrate the potential to raise awareness and recognize outstanding service in the sector. However, entities focused solely on direct patient services without an advocacy or recognition component may not find eligibility within this funding framework.

Supportive Factors for Alignment To align with the objectives of this funding, applicants should emphasize community engagement strategies and outline how their recognition programs will lead to improved public perception and professional morale. Strong proposals typically highlight partnerships with advocacy groups or media outlets to maximize outreach, ensuring that the recognition system serves not just the recipients but also the broader community narrative around abortion services.

Creating a robust recognition program not only uplifts individual practitioners but also contributes to systemic changes in societal views towards reproductive health, ultimately fostering a supportive environment for continued access to essential services.
